Follow these detailed steps to ensure your wooden barn door installation goes efficiently:
1. Measure the Door Opening
Step the interior opening, keeping in mind the width and height. It's vital to ensure your barn Door Installation Professionals will fit without limitation.
2. Select Your Barn Door
Select a wooden barn door that fits your measurements and wanted design. Custom alternatives are available, or you can select pre-made doors.
3. Prepare the Wall
Use a stud finder to locate the studs in the wall where the track will be mounted. Mark these spots plainly with a pencil.
4. Install the Track
With your drill, mount the track along the wall at the height where you want the door to rest. Guarantee it is level and protected to the wall studs. The track should extend beyond the door width by about 6 inches on either side.
5. Attach the Rollers to the Door
Follow the producer's directions to attach the rollers to the top of the wooden barn door. This generally includes drilling holes for the screws included in your hardware set.
6. Hang the Door
Thoroughly lift the door onto the set up track, making sure the rollers fit firmly. Confirm that the door slides smoothly and is level.
7. Set Up the Door Stop
Mount the door stop on the track at both ends to avoid the door from sliding off. Adjust as necessary to ensure a tight fit.
8. Add Optional Hardware
Consider adding a handle or lock system to your barn door for ease of use.
9. Finishing Touches
If wanted, use paint or wood finish to the door for protection and enhanced looks.
Maintenance Tips for Wooden Barn Doors
To keep your barn Best Door Installation Company in great condition, consider the following upkeep suggestions:
Regularly Check Hardware: Periodically inspect the track and rollers for wear and tear. Tighten screws as needed.
Clean and Polish: Dust the door routinely and use wood polish to keep its shine and defense.
Prevent Excessive Moisture: Keep the location around the door dry to prevent wood warping.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How much does it cost to install a wooden barn door?
The cost can vary considerably based on door size, product, and hardware picked. Usually, anticipate to pay between ₤ 200 to ₤ 800 for materials, including the hardware kit.
2. Can I install a barn door by myself?
Yes! Many property owners select to undertake this DIY job. Nevertheless, assistance may be handy for lifting.
3. What is the very best wood for barn doors?
Common options consist of pine, cedar, and reclaimed wood. Choose wood based upon your desired appearance and local climate conditions.
4. Do I need a separator wall?
Normally, barn doors do not need a separator wall, however make sure that there is sufficient wall length to accommodate the slide.
5. Can wooden barn doors be utilized outside?
While they can be used outdoors, guarantee you select weather-resistant wood and surface for exterior applications.
